Abstract: | GNSS carrier phase ambiguity resolution is the key for precise relative positioning solutions. Precise GNSS-based attitude determination applications require a fast and reliable ambiguity estimation. For these applications, a frame of GNSS antennas is firmly mounted onboard the platform, at known relative positions. The full set of geometrical constraints is embedded in the algorithm, aiding the ambiguity resolution process by means of strengthening the functional model. In this contribution a method to integrally solve for the carrier phase ambiguities and attitude of the platform exploiting all the a-priori geometrical constraints is described and tested. The superior performance in terms of single-frequency, single-epoch fixing rate are demonstrated through static and dynamic tests. |
